Gerenciando apps personalizados usando AEMC

  • Versão de lançamento: Zurich
  • Atualizado 31 de jul. de 2025
  • 4 min. de leitura
  • Revise métricas de app personalizadas e gerencie apps por meio do ciclo de vida de desenvolvimento usando o. Central de gestão do App Engine( AEMC).

    . App Engineseção de métricas de adoção do AEMCA página de visão geral mostra quantos apps você tem em ambientes de desenvolvimento e produção. Para acessar mais informações, selecione o número grande em cada cartão de apps personalizados.

    A página Apps personalizados em AEMCmostra métricas mais detalhadas e uma lista completa de suas aplicações. Em cada bloco na seção Status do ciclo de vida do app personalizado, você pode ver os dados de tendências dos últimos 90 dias. Você pode mostrar todos os apps na lista de apps personalizados ou limitar a lista a apenas determinados tipos de aplicações que usam o filtro. Selecione um gráfico de tendências para filtrar a lista de acordo com esses critérios.

    Página de app personalizada, com métricas de alto nível e lista de todos os apps

    A página do app personalizado também lista todas as aplicações individualmente, com um único registro para cada aplicação. Se o app tiver sido publicado na produção, o. Versão publicada a coluna mostra o número da versão. . Versão publicada a coluna está em branco, o app existe em desenvolvimento, mas nunca foi publicado para produção.

    Lista de todos os apps personalizados

    Exibir os dados de uso do app, detalhes de monitoramento de assinatura, histórico de implantação e colaboradores, se houver, selecionando um nome de aplicação na lista.

    Detalhes na página de registro de uma aplicação.

    Selecione Abrir no App Engine Studio para ver o conteúdo do app e acessar mais informações. . App Engine Studioa aplicação é aberta em uma nova janela do navegador.

    Uso da app

    Para obter uma exibição de alto nível dos dados de uso de apps em instâncias de produção, selecione Uso do app . Os dados incluem a contagem de usuários, contagem de inserção e contagem de atualizações agregadas para o mês atual.
    • Contagem de usuários: O número de usuários que acessaram a aplicação.
    • Inserir contagem: O número de novos registros nas tabelas na aplicação.
    • Contagem de atualizações: O número de registros na aplicação que foram atualizados.
    Conhecer os dados de uso de suas aplicações tem vários benefícios:
    • Descubra se seu app está sendo usado. As pessoas estão usando o app? Eles estão criando registros? Caso contrário, considere atualizar ou excluir o app.
    • Investigue e corrija problemas com o app. Saber quando ou como os dados foram alterados pode ajudar a identificar onde algo deu errado.
    • Determine se você precisa balancear a carga do poder de processamento da sua instância vendo quando pode haver tráfego consistentemente maior no seu app.

    Na seção Painéis da Análise da experiência do usuário, veja dados detalhados, como usuários ativos, sessões e exibições de página, selecionando uma experiência. Para obter mais informações sobre como entender e usar esses dados, consulte Análise da experiência do usuário .

    Monitoramento de assinatura

    Entenda as funções usadas em sua aplicação personalizada e suas implicações para licenciamento e assinaturas. Os dados nesta seção incluem detalhes sobre cada função e os usuários atribuídos a cada função.

    Conhecer as informações de dados de assinatura e licenciamento de cada uma de suas aplicações tem vários benefícios:
    • Descubra quais funções estão ativas em sua aplicação personalizada.
    • Descubra quais usuários estão atribuídos a cada função e os níveis de permissão que eles têm.
    • Veja as implicações de custo de cada tipo de licença e onde ele é usado em seus apps.
    Os administradores do sistema podem ver para qual assinatura o app está mapeado e têm a opção de mudar a assinatura. Vários fatores afetam o que você vê nesta seção.
    • Se o app estiver mapeado para um App Engine. Monitoramento de assinatura a guia está visível.
    • Se o app estiver mapeado para uma assinatura diferente, como ITSM, o. Monitoramento de assinatura a guia não está visível.
    • Se o app estiver mapeado para App Engine, é alterado para outra assinatura e, em seguida, é alterado de volta para App Engine. Monitoramento de assinatura a guia está visível novamente.

    App Engine os administradores não têm permissões para mudar assinaturas. No entanto, se um app estiver no ambiente de produção e houver um Monitoramento de assinatura . App Engineo administrador pode inferir que o app está mapeado para um App Engineassinatura. . Monitoramento de assinatura a guia não está lá, para a qual o app não está mapeado App Engine.

    Você pode selecionar o nome de um usuário no Usuários atribuídos para ver um mapa de herança de função. Este mapa mostra como este usuário herdou a função, seja de uma função primária, de uma atribuição de grupo ou de outra herança. Essas informações podem ajudar você a agir se alguém tiver uma função que você acredita que não deveria e você quiser mudá-la.
    Figura 1. Mapa de herança de função
    Mapa de herança de função, mostrando como um usuário obteve suas funções

    Implantações de aplicações

    Veja a lista de implantações pelas quais seu app passou no Histórico de implantação .

    Conhecer as informações do histórico de implantação tem vários benefícios:
    • Se um app for implantado na produção e houver um defeito, você poderá ver rapidamente quando o app foi implantado e rastrear o problema.
    • Se um app for implantado várias vezes, você poderá acompanhar rapidamente o que mudou em várias implantações.
    • Se um app for implantado na produção, você poderá ver rapidamente quem aprovou a implantação do app.

    Colaboradores do app

    Para exibir os colaboradores do app, selecione Colaboradores . Todos os colaboradores são armazenados na instância de Desenvolvimento.

    Se você precisar executar uma ação rápida na aplicação para corrigir um problema ou defeito, poderá ver rapidamente quem tem permissões para fazer mudanças em um app e quais são essas permissões.